Join the Central PA Mushroom Club on Saturday, November 1st, at the Penn State University Paterno Library to take a tour of the Kneebone Mushroom Reference Collection and listen to educational talks on mushroom research at Penn State University.
When: November 1st, 2025, at 1 PM Eastern
Where: Foster Auditorium, Paterno Library, Penn State University Park campus in State College, PA

Activities planned include the following:
Kneebone Mushroom Reference Collection (KMRC) Tours
Visit and overview of KMRC by Janet A Hughes
Janet is the Biological Sciences Librarian at Penn State. Tours will be limited to 8-10 visitors at a time. Those interested in visiting the KMRC will do so in small groups. Foster Auditorium - Educational Talks:
1. "The history of Penn State mushroom patents" presentation from Denise A. Wetzel.
Denise is a Science and Engineering Librarian at Penn State and also the representative for the Patent and Trademark Resource Center Representative at Penn State.
2. "Mushroom Research Center overview" presentation from Nicholas A Gabel.
Nick is a Research Technologist at the Penn State University Mushroom Research Center.
3. "Accessing the Penn State Libraries print and online library resources for Pennsylvania Residents" presentation from Pembroke Childs.
Pembroke is a Library Services Associate in the Common Services Department. The presentation will include the who (PA residents), what (print and online resources), where (University Park and Commonwealth Campuses), and how (to request and use materials) basics. Pembroke will be available to answer questions and process PA Resident library cards and accounts so you can get started right away.
